Python如何建立集合
在Python编程语言中,集合是一种非常实用的数据结构。集合可以让你存储一堆元素,并且这些元素不会有重复的,非常适合对数据进行去重或者快速的查找。本文将介绍python如何建立集合,并且探讨一些集合的常用操作。
什么是集合
集合是一种无序的、可迭代的、可变的数据类型,它长得像一个列表,但是它里面的元素是唯一的,没有重复。
如何创建一个集合
在Python中,你可以使用两种方式创建集合。
方式一:使用花括号({})创建
花括号({})可以用来创建集合,但是要注意,如果你使用{}来创建空集合,你实际上创建的是一个空字典而不是一个集合。因此,当你要创建空集合时,应该使用set()函数。
以下代码展示了如何通过花括号和set()函数分别创建集合。
# 使用花括号创建集合
my_set = {'apple', 'banana', 'orange'}
print(my_set)
# 使用set()函数创建集合
my_set = set(['apple', 'banana', 'orange'])
print(my_set)
# 创建空集合
empty_set = set()
print(empty_set)
输出结果:
{'orange', 'banana', 'apple'}
{'orange', 'banana', 'apple'}
set()
</